Originally Posted by oweng View Post
as i don't want to take advantage of Frals time and effort I was wondering if anyone in the UK on vodafone could give me a hand with this.

to the best of my knowledge I have configured the MMS APN using fAPN, adding wap address, user name, password, proxy and port details.

I have also configured settings in fMMS http://mms.vodafone........ etc etc

added my number and the resize, set the correct APN to use....

out of ideas
oweng, I'm with Vodafone UK and not managed to get MMS (fMMS) working, yet. I've just upgraded to V 0.7.2 and will keep trying, but from the error in the log it appears to be a VF problem:

e.g.
2010-04-16 18:19:39,342 fmms.wappushhandler: MMSC RESPONDED: {'Response-Text': 'Unable To Send', 'MMS-Version': '1.0', 'Response-Status': 'Error-service-denied', 'Message-ID': 'KpzIS8YSG4KRSAAAsAt44l-GAAAAAAAA'}


...what is you log showing ?


Is anyone successfully using fMMS on Vodafone(UK) with a N900 supplied with a new SIM (i.e. the SIM has not been taken from a phone which used MMS)

well would you believe it afer 5 phone calls since wednesday, I spent an hour in a vodafone store over lunch to eventually find out that vodafone had barred mms on my account. noone could tell me why...

so frals, great news fmms works perfectly!


Originally Posted by frals View Post
Yes, it's possible - and since you can browse using it settings should be fine. Give Vodafone another call and tell them the MMSC is rejecting you
